Punakha District is a region in Bhutan known for its stunning natural landscapes, including the fertile Punakha Valley, the Mo Chhu and Pho Chhu rivers, and lush forests. It is a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ts who enjoy trekking, hiking, and nature walks. The district is home to the historic Punakha Dzong, a majestic fortress-monastery, and offers opportunities to explore rural villages and terraced fields. The mild climate makes it a pleasant area to visit year-round, with spring and autumn being particularly beautiful.
